Dracula is a classic horror novel for a reason. Scarier than the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de and as easy to immerse yourself in as Oscar Wilde's The Portrait of Dorian Gray, Dracula is a brilliant read from start to finish. It's the begginning thats the most scary, when Johnathon Harker is narrating the story, but that doesn't mean that the novel loses its effect from there on in. Dracula is a must read for anyone who loves to scare themselves.
